>>>Would any one tell me how to make a auto reply "Y" to the question on
>>>force check the file system after the Fedora Core hang and reboot? Any
>>>script needed and how to add it ? Because sometimes the linux is not
>>>installed with monitor on boot.
>>>
>>>
>>>Wong Kwok Hon
>>>
>>>
>>Create a file like following:
>>
>>$ cat /etc/sysconfig/autofsck
>>
>>AUTOFSCK_DEF_CHECK=yes
>>PROMPT=yes
>>AUTOFSCK_TIMEOUT=10
>>AUTOFSCK_OPT=""
